Last Saturday, an 81-year old lady called Click and Clack on NPR, specifically to ask a question that is related to this thread. She inherited a '73 Impala (4-dr), with a 400SB. She had used an additive, occasionally. However, the car only had 28K miles on it. They told her that she shouldn't worry about it and just drive it. They did say, though, that if she was driving it hard, i.e., on the freeway or at higher speeds, that the hardened seats would be the right way to go.

I had a 230CID head rebuilt and had the hardened seats installed. Then, I sold the truck...but not before I had it running.
Ditto I ran a 040 over 327 , with a set of 492 castings(z28/Lt1). the heads were fully prepped(bronze liners, fresh valves, springs, & a 3 angle job with a little bowl work & port match). This was an intown truck, running a car 4spd trans, & 3.73 gears. no long hyway miles, or heavy towing. that little sb ran like stink on unleaded pump fuel for 30,000 miles, till i revved her a little tight & had a rod pecking. I sold the heads to a bud, & after a quick lap , & seals they were back into service on his Nova! my guess is that he has logged another 10,000 miles & the eng still sounds great! those heads were cranked next to 7000 rpms, for a few gears from time to time.....but never towed heavy loads, or ran high speed for many miles on the hyway. no fuel addative was ever used..... crazyL
